Realband will do exactly what you want. By default, it never regenerates a track - even after exiting the program (provided you have saved the file as a SEQ file).

Here's a tip, though. To get the song to sound the same in Realband as it does in BIAB, you will need to set the panning and volume of the individual instruments. It is really easy to do.
  • Open the song in BIAB
  • Make a note of each track's pan and vol settings
  • Open RB
  • Right-click on the vol sliders of individual tracks and enter the BIAB volumes
  • Right-click on the panning sliders and enter the individual values found in BIAB
  • Save the file as a RB file (it will default to SEQ)

Now you can exit RB and the song will be exactly same when you reopen it. You can also regenerate individual tracks or even parts of individual tracks. It's brilliant software for maximizing the effectiveness of RealTracks.
